2025-05-21 03:12:17
214

Mac云服务器配置指南:云端搭建与远程连接优化实践

摘要
目录导航 一、云服务商选择与实例创建 二、基础环境配置流程 三、远程连接工具与优化 四、安全加固与性能调优 一、云服务商选择与实例创建 选择云服务商时需优先考虑对macOS的原生支持,专业服务商如MacStadium提供专用Mac硬件服务器,适合长期稳定需求;AWS EC2则支持临时测试场景,可按需选择实例规格。创建实…...

一、云服务商选择与实例创建

选择云服务商时需优先考虑对macOS的原生支持,专业服务商如MacStadium提供专用Mac硬件服务器,适合长期稳定需求;AWS EC2则支持临时测试场景,可按需选择实例规格。创建实例时需注意:

  1. 选择macOS Ventura或更新版本的系统镜像
  2. 配置至少4核CPU、8GB内存的基础规格
  3. 设置SSH密钥对并下载.pem格式私钥文件

二、基础环境配置流程

通过SSH完成初始连接后,建议执行以下配置步骤:

  • 安装Homebrew包管理器:/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"
  • 配置防火墙规则,开放22(SSH)、5900(VNC)、3389(RDP)等必要端口
  • 安装自动化运维工具Ansible或Docker容器环境
典型端口配置表
协议 端口 用途
SSH 22 命令行管理
RDP 3389 远程桌面
VNC 5900 图形界面

三、远程连接工具与优化

针对不同使用场景推荐以下连接方案:

  • SSH连接优化:在~/.ssh/config中添加ServerAliveInterval 60保持长连接,使用ssh-agent管理密钥
  • 图形界面工具:Royal TSX支持多协议管理和会话保持,免费版支持10个连接
  • 网络加速:通过Cloudflare Tunnel建立私有化通道降低延迟

四、安全加固与性能调优

完成基础部署后需执行安全审计:

  1. 禁用root账户远程登录,创建sudo权限子账户
  2. 配置fail2ban防止暴力破解,设置登录失败锁定策略
  3. 启用磁盘加密并设置自动快照策略

性能优化建议启用ZFS文件系统,通过sysctl -w kern.maxfiles=1048600提升文件句柄上限,定期使用Activity Monitor分析资源占用。

通过合理选择云服务商、规范配置流程以及持续优化连接方案,可在Mac云服务器上构建稳定高效的生产环境。建议每月执行安全补丁更新,结合自动化运维工具实现配置版本化管理。

声明:文章不代表云主机测评网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!
回顶部